#34e9f8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#34e9f8 is composed of 20.4% red, 91.4% green and 97.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79% cyan, 6%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 184.6 degrees, a saturation of 93.3% and a lightness of 58.8%. #34e9f8 color hex could be obtained by blending #68ffff with #00d3f1. Closest websafe color is: #33ffff.

Shades and Tints of #34e9f8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000506 is the darkest color, while #f2feff is the lightest one.

Tones of #34e9f8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#959797 is the less saturated color, while #34e9f8 is the most saturated one.
